This position leads the operations of the Motion Analysis lab and will work closely with the CP Physician Director to coordinate the clinical and research aims of the Motion Analysis Lab. This position is responsible for providing leadership and direction to the motion analysis lab staff, including the support and partnership to recruit and the training of staff. They are also responsible for developing policies and procedures for motion analysis lab operations. They will function as an independent investigator with complete responsibility for his/her research program and will be expected to establish a strong record of research & scholarship. The role will serve in a leadership role in the interpretation of full-body kinematics and kinetics of gait, running, and other human performance activities. They will be expected to maintain independent extramural funding. They will develop and sustain productive, collaborative relationships within and outside the organization at the national level. They will be expected to participate in hospital or professional service activities and may serve in a leadership capacity in professional organizations. Applies extensive knowledge of clinical research protocols and processes to design research projects of large scope and high degrees of complexity.
